I Sent My LG CordZero Vacuum for Repair but Still Can’t Use It After 20+ Days

I’m extremely frustrated with the after-sales experience for my LG CordZero vacuum cleaner. The motorized head started making loud rattling noises and stopped functioning properly. Since the vacuum is under warranty and I also purchased extra insurance, I sent it in for repair over 20 days ago.

Today, I received a call informing me that I’ll need to wait another 4 weeks because the product is “still under repair.” What exactly has been done in the past three weeks? I wasn’t updated once until now. I asked if they could replace it instead to avoid further inconvenience, but I was told, “No, we can’t.”

So now I’m facing a total wait time of 6 weeks with no working vacuum in the meantime, despite owning a high-end product with both warranty and insurance coverage. This level of service is absolutely unacceptable from a brand like LG.
